Handover Note — Directors Farrow to Quill. Branch managers: next year's headcount plan is drafted, not signed off. Net add of twelve roles, weighted to the Astermere branches; back-office flat. Freeze stays until Q1 budget lock. Quill owns final allocations from Monday. Escalate exceptions through her office only. The confidential planning note is appended below.

board note of kageg-bahof: The renewal with Holwynax Holdings closes at $2 million a year, 5 percent below the last contract. Project Ulaath slips by two quarters because of the supplier delay.

Minutes — Management Meeting, Orvale Systems Sales Division

Present: regional sales leads and Ms. Halloway (Finance). The proposed training budget for next year was set at a 6% increase over the current cycle, prioritising the new Cindermark product certification. Two external courses will be replaced with in-house sessions run from the Dunlora office. Sales leads must submit headcount-based training needs by the 15th. A confidential note follows for your attention.

board note of kafog-bajep: Briathek Partners is in early talks to buy Aldaelek Group for about $47.1 million. The Ulaath launch date is September 4, and nothing goes to the press before then.

## v2.14.1

Fixed session-token refresh bug in Gatewick. Tokens expiring during an active request were not renewed, logging users out mid-session. Refresh now retries once with backoff. Affects all tenants on the Larkspur tier. No user action needed; cached sessions recover automatically. Escalate recurrences to the owner named below.

account owner for bawip-tahag: Raleth Quenok

Subject: Gateway rate limits going live Thursday

Hi all — quick heads-up for the newer folks: the Coppergate internal API gateway gets per-service rate limits starting Thursday. Defaults are generous (600 req/min), but chatty batch jobs should switch to the bulk endpoints now rather than after you hit 429s. Dashboards in Glimmerboard show your current usage per route. Questions go to the platform channel. This rollout ships under the build token below.

session token of fahop-tawig = htk3_da3